Quick Education
What actually makes
a chamois different?
Ride Duration
Different foam densities and constructions provide support for different amounts of time in the saddle.
Density
Higher-density areas provide additional support in the zones that experience the most pressure.
Shape & Anatomy
The shape of the chamois affects stability, pressure distribution, movement, and riding comfort.
Breathability
Perforation, fabrics, and moisture-management technology help control heat and moisture during long rides.
How It Works
More than padding.
A performance chamois isn't simply a layer of foam. Its shape, foam density, surface material, ventilation and anatomical construction work together to manage pressure, movement, heat and moisture while you're riding.
Surface Fabric
The layer against the skin. It moves moisture away, controls friction and keeps the surface temperature manageable.
Foam / Density Structure
One or more foam densities shaped to support the sit bones, relieve the centre line and hold thickness only where it is useful.
Anatomical Base
The pre-shaped backing that gives the pad its curvature so it sits stable against the body in the riding position.
